Netflix's beloved series Emily in Paris is set to conclude with its upcoming sixth season, as confirmed by the show's creator. The final season, currently filming in picturesque locations such as Greece and Monaco, will see Lily Collins reprise her iconic role as the spirited marketing executive Emily Cooper.
Creator and Star React to Final Season
Series creator Darren Star expressed his heartfelt gratitude to fans in a statement to Variety, reflecting on the show's remarkable journey. Meanwhile, Collins took to Instagram on Thursday with a video message, promising viewers a "fantastic farewell season" filled with the charm and drama that have captivated audiences worldwide.
Massive Global Success
Despite receiving mixed critical reviews throughout its run, Emily in Paris has undeniably been a monumental hit for Netflix. The most recent season amassed an impressive 26.8 million global views within just 11 days of its release, underscoring the show's widespread popularity and cultural impact.

The inclusion of filming locations in Greece and Monaco suggests that the final season will expand beyond Paris, offering new scenic backdrops and potential storylines. The sixth and final season of Emily in Paris is anticipated to premiere on Netflix in late 2026.
